My Motivation

I wanted to share some snip its from some e-mails that I have received from various people who have found my blog. All of these e-mails give me so much more motivation to put myself out there even more. It makes me so sad that people all over the world are suffering quietly with keloids. I want to be there for each and every one of them. I not only want them to know that they are not alone, but that with the right doctor and method, they can find relief.

"I was going to tell you, I have purchased soooooooooooo MANY creams, oils, ointments to help my keloids over the years. It's sad. Nothing has ever helped. My parents are Middle Eastern so they are true believers in homeopathic medicine and herbal meds, they have tried to buy me countless creams from overseas to help with my keloids and nothing ever helped. Sure, some creams softened my keloids a bit, but never removed them completely."

"It's super admirable how you are taking a stand and getting this condition out there, not many of us with condition could do that, it's hard. I am so self conscious of my own keloids - haven't worn a tank top in years :( I hope dermatologists or plastic surgeons come out with a way to cure keloids."

"I got your email off of your blog, and I just wanted to say OMG thank you so much for starting your blog! I finally don't feel so alone. I have been struggling with keloids since I was about 12 due to some acne on my shoulders which have turned into painful keloids."

"Thank you, :') your words are beautiful. You are an inspiration for me it is almost hard to get up courage to wear short sleeyes ves or shirts because with keloids I have more than 50 not as big but they are all big :/ they cause me to be self concsious"

"This second scar has been my problem child, finding shirts and dresses that aren't cut low is nearly impossible (and really frustrating).  I finally gave up on going to dermatologists a few years ago because they only offered me steroid shots, surgery, or laser treatments.  Surgery and lasers were out, so I just put dealing with it on the back burner."

"Thanks so much!! It is sooo comforting to know we're not alone isn't it!?? Also, makes your heart sink a bit (or a lot) when you lose sight of that hope...when the reality hits that there's no sure cure!"


Although we are all so different, we are all the same. We all want to feel good about out ourselves and be free from pain.
